I don't know how to respond directly to the guide so let me just reply here. I want to share these additional piece of information regarding Damage-Up. Most importantly is the first one which tells you how much percentage your damage increases by you get when equipping Damage-Up (it's in the red circle). There's also a chart describing the damage caps that most weapons have, for example the Aerospray normally hits for 24.5 damage but no matter how much Damage-Up you equip it will never increase more than 24.9 because that is its damage cap.

Also there's a weird little thing about the RainMaker's shield, which usually takes 1,000 damage before it pops, but some weapons do increased damage to it. For example to pop the Rainmaker's shield it will take 6 Ink Mines, or 3 Splat/Suction Bombs, or 2 Seekers, even though they all normally do the same 180.0 damage. Thank you for the nice guide.
